Garth Brooks To Host First-Ever Gillette Stadium Show

ON SALE: July 16 at 10:00 AM

Saturday, October 9, 2021, at 7:00 PM inside Gillette Stadium on 1 Patriot Pl, Foxborough, MA 02035

The Garth Brooks Stadium Tour looks to touchdown in New England for an electrifying show this fall, a sight many music lovers have longed to see. Brooks looks to return to the Boston market for the first time in six years as he takes center stage to host his first-ever show at Gillette Stadium!

The show will mark the return of live music at Gillette Stadium, a notable moment many of us have been waiting for. Brooks looks to bring his robust musical force to Foxborough on October 9th to perform classic hits and as the top-selling solo artist in U.S. history, you can expect tickets to sell fast! The Garth Brooks Stadium Tour has already shattered attendance records across the country, setting an all-time attendance record in over 75 cities so far. Tickets for the Gillette Stadium show will go on sale Friday, July 16 at 10:00 AM.

You can expect the seating at Gillette Stadium to be formatted in-the-round (pictured below) and tickets will be $94.95 each after fees and taxes. There is an eight-ticket limit per purchaser and there will be no advance box office / general ticket sales at the Gillette Stadium Ticket Office in advance of the show.

Fans have the option to purchase tickets in three ways:

  1. Online at ticketmaster.com

  2. Calling the Garth Brooks line through Ticketmaster at 1-877-654-2784

  3. Using the Ticketmaster app

Fans are prompted to visit www.ticketmaster.com/garthbrooks and click on “On Sale Tips & Hints”, located in the center of the page. Fans can create an account or refresh their existing Ticketmaster account for a quicker purchasing experience.
